The Fine Print Nobody Reads (But You Should Glance At)
Alright, I’m going to be honest with you. I hate reading terms and conditions. My eyes glaze over. But I have learned the hard way that you need to look at two specific numbers:
- The Wagering Requirement: If it says “35x bonus + deposit”, that is standard. If it says “50x”, run.
- The Max Bet Rule: A lot of sites say “Max bet while bonus is active: £5”. If you accidentally bet £5.50, they void your winnings. I’ve done it. It hurts.
For example, PlayOJO has a “No Wagering” policy. You win, you keep it. That is rare and valuable. Mr Green sometimes offers bonuses with a “Max Cashout” of £100. That’s fine for a free spin bonus, but not great if you hit a big win. Check this stuff.

Are there any deposit fees?
Usually, no. Most sites do not charge fees for debit cards (Visa, Mastercard) or e-wallets (PayPal, Skrill). But check your bank. Some banks charge a small fee for gambling transactions. I lost a fiver that way once. Annoying.
How fast is the withdrawal?
From what I’ve seen, e-wallets are the fastest. PayPal can be instant. Debit cards take 1-3 days. Bank transfers can take up to 5 days. Unibet is usually very fast. Mr Green sometimes holds withdrawals for 48 hours for “security checks”. It’s a pain, but it stops fraud.
Can I set deposit limits?
Yes. And you should. The UKGC requires all sites to offer deposit limits. You can set a daily, weekly, or monthly limit. I set a weekly limit of £100. It stops me from chasing losses when I’m tired. It’s a good habit.
